The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Driving Licence in permanent job vacancies in the East of England.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that cited Driving Licence over the 6 months leading up to 13 August 2026,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
13 Aug 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 37 12 50
Rank change year-on-year -25 +38 +61
Permanent jobs citing Driving Licence 237 386 169
As % of all permanent jobs in the East of England 3.27% 11.20% 3.60%
As % of the Miscellaneous category 12.68% 28.66% 12.47%
Number of salaries quoted 209 57 57
10th Percentile £26,300 £25,300 £23,000
25th Percentile £30,000 £29,000 £24,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£35,000 £42,500 £31,198
Median % change year-on-year -17.65% +36.23% -5.46%
75th Percentile £43,750 £53,750 £35,000
90th Percentile £57,500 £55,250 £40,250
England median annual salary £38,500 £37,000 £32,500
% change year-on-year +4.05% +13.85% -1.52%
